<title>raw: fsync method is now required</title>
<updated>2010-04-07T15:38:04+00:00</updated>
<author>
<name>Anton Blanchard</name>
<email>anton@samba.org</email>
</author>
<published>2010-04-06T21:34:58+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=55ab3a1ff843e3f0e24d2da44e71bffa5d853010'/>
<id>urn:sha1:55ab3a1ff843e3f0e24d2da44e71bffa5d853010</id>
<content type='text'>
Commit 148f948ba877f4d3cdef036b1ff6d9f68986706a (vfs: Introduce new
helpers for syncing after writing to O_SYNC file or IS_SYNC inode) broke
the raw driver.

We now call through generic_file_aio_write -&gt; generic_write_sync -&gt;
vfs_fsync_range.  vfs_fsync_range has:

        if (!fop || !fop-&gt;fsync) {
                ret = -EINVAL;
                goto out;
        }

But drivers/char/raw.c doesn't set an fsync method.

We have two options: fix it or remove the raw driver completely.  I'm
happy to do either, the fact this has been broken for so long suggests it
is rarely used.

The patch below adds an fsync method to the raw driver.  My knowledge of
the block layer is pretty sketchy so this could do with a once over.

If we instead decide to remove the raw driver, this patch might still be
useful as a backport to 2.6.33 and 2.6.32.

<title>include cleanup: Update gfp.h and slab.h includes to prepare for breaking implicit slab.h inclusion from percpu.h</title>
<updated>2010-03-30T13:02:32+00:00</updated>
<author>
<name>Tejun Heo</name>
<email>tj@kernel.org</email>
</author>
<published>2010-03-24T08:04:11+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=5a0e3ad6af8660be21ca98a971cd00f331318c05'/>
<id>urn:sha1:5a0e3ad6af8660be21ca98a971cd00f331318c05</id>
<content type='text'>
percpu.h is included by sched.h and module.h and thus ends up being
included when building most .c files.  percpu.h includes slab.h which
in turn includes gfp.h making everything defined by the two files
universally available and complicating inclusion dependencies.

percpu.h -&gt; slab.h dependency is about to be removed.  Prepare for
this change by updating users of gfp and slab facilities include those
headers directly instead of assuming availability.  As this conversion
needs to touch large number of source files, the following script is
used as the basis of conversion.

  http://userweb.kernel.org/~tj/misc/slabh-sweep.py

The script does the followings.

* Scan files for gfp and slab usages and update includes such that
  only the necessary includes are there.  ie. if only gfp is used,
  gfp.h, if slab is used, slab.h.

* When the script inserts a new include, it looks at the include
  blocks and try to put the new include such that its order conforms
  to its surrounding.  It's put in the include block which contains
  core kernel includes, in the same order that the rest are ordered -
  alphabetical, Christmas tree, rev-Xmas-tree or at the end if there
  doesn't seem to be any matching order.

* If the script can't find a place to put a new include (mostly
  because the file doesn't have fitting include block), it prints out
  an error message indicating which .h file needs to be added to the
  file.

The conversion was done in the following steps.

1. The initial automatic conversion of all .c files updated slightly
   over 4000 files, deleting around 700 includes and adding ~480 gfp.h
   and ~3000 slab.h inclusions.  The script emitted errors for ~400
   files.

2. Each error was manually checked.  Some didn't need the inclusion,
   some needed manual addition while adding it to implementation .h or
   embedding .c file was more appropriate for others.  This step added
   inclusions to around 150 files.

3. The script was run again and the output was compared to the edits
   from #2 to make sure no file was left behind.

4. Several build tests were done and a couple of problems were fixed.
   e.g. lib/decompress_*.c used malloc/free() wrappers around slab
   APIs requiring slab.h to be added manually.

5. The script was run on all .h files but without automatically
   editing them as sprinkling gfp.h and slab.h inclusions around .h
   files could easily lead to inclusion dependency hell.  Most gfp.h
   inclusion directives were ignored as stuff from gfp.h was usually
   wildly available and often used in preprocessor macros.  Each
   slab.h inclusion directive was examined and added manually as
   necessary.

6. percpu.h was updated not to include slab.h.

7. Build test were done on the following configurations and failures
   were fixed.  CONFIG_GCOV_KERNEL was turned off for all tests (as my
   distributed build env didn't work with gcov compiles) and a few
   more options had to be turned off depending on archs to make things
   build (like ipr on powerpc/64 which failed due to missing writeq).

   * x86 and x86_64 UP and SMP allmodconfig and a custom test config.
   * powerpc and powerpc64 SMP allmodconfig
   * sparc and sparc64 SMP allmodconfig
   * ia64 SMP allmodconfig
   * s390 SMP allmodconfig
   * alpha SMP allmodconfig
   * um on x86_64 SMP allmodconfig

8. percpu.h modifications were reverted so that it could be applied as
   a separate patch and serve as bisection point.

Given the fact that I had only a couple of failures from tests on step
6, I'm fairly confident about the coverage of this conversion patch.
If there is a breakage, it's likely to be something in one of the arch
headers which should be easily discoverable easily on most builds of
the specific arch.

<title>Driver-Core: extend devnode callbacks to provide permissions</title>
<updated>2009-09-19T19:50:38+00:00</updated>
<author>
<name>Kay Sievers</name>
<email>kay.sievers@vrfy.org</email>
</author>
<published>2009-09-18T21:01:12+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=e454cea20bdcff10ee698d11b8882662a0153a47'/>
<id>urn:sha1:e454cea20bdcff10ee698d11b8882662a0153a47</id>
<content type='text'>
This allows subsytems to provide devtmpfs with non-default permissions
for the device node. Instead of the default mode of 0600, null, zero,
random, urandom, full, tty, ptmx now have a mode of 0666, which allows
non-privileged processes to access standard device nodes in case no
other userspace process applies the expected permissions.

This also fixes a wrong assignment in pktcdvd and a checkpatch.pl complain.

<title>block: Do away with the notion of hardsect_size</title>
<updated>2009-05-22T21:22:54+00:00</updated>
<author>
<name>Martin K. Petersen</name>
<email>martin.petersen@oracle.com</email>
</author>
<published>2009-05-22T21:17:49+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=e1defc4ff0cf57aca6c5e3ff99fa503f5943c1f1'/>
<id>urn:sha1:e1defc4ff0cf57aca6c5e3ff99fa503f5943c1f1</id>
<content type='text'>
Until now we have had a 1:1 mapping between storage device physical
block size and the logical block sized used when addressing the device.
With SATA 4KB drives coming out that will no longer be the case.  The
sector size will be 4KB but the logical block size will remain
512-bytes.  Hence we need to distinguish between the physical block size
and the logical ditto.

This patch renames hardsect_size to logical_block_size.
